Web13 Apr 2024 · Ksp = [Fe2+] ⋅ [S2−] Notice that for every 1 mole of iron (II) sulfide that dissociates in aqueous solution, you get 1 mole of iron (II) cations and 1 mole of sulfide anions. This means that the equilibrium concentrations of the two ions will be equal to the molar solubility of the salt. Therefore, you can say that Ksp = 6.31 ⋅ 10−10 ⋅ 6.31 ⋅ 10−10
